Product Description

Product Description

The Chugger Championship is a kid-powered crank launcher playset. Race engines separately or connect them to race longer trains. Automatic features in the destinations enhance the high-paced fun by changing the actions of the racing engines. Trophy pops-up to show the winner. Fuel up and race again.

Product Description

Start at the gate! Zoom through the crank launcher! Win the trophy! The Chugger Championship Rev'n Race Deluxe Playset is kid-powered and does not require batteries. Place Koko in the automatic gate and start cranking to watch her zoom through the track! When Koko wins, the trophy pops up as she completes a victory lap and refuels at the fuel depot. This huge set has a layout over 4 feet long, and includes Chugger Chamopionship Koko. Also works with other Chugger Championship Die-Cast Engines and regular Chuggignton Die-Cast Engines. Recommended For Ages 3 Plus

We are so disappointed in this toy. As is often the case, looked great on the packaging and we thought it would be ideal for our 3 boys of 5, 3 and 2 - all 3 of them love trains. When we started putting it together the doubt crept in, the pieces were REALLY hard to click into place (and my husband is excellent at putting things together and DIY etc), had to put a lot of force into it. Then the actual fun part was NOT fun, there is no WAY a 3, 4 or even 5 year old could get this train to go around the track as it's meant to. The boys have been pretty much ignoring it since we produced it a few days ago. I would not recommend this toy to anyone and I will definitely not buy any chuggington stuff - ever again!

I bought the item on Christmas for my 5 year old boy. He was ober excited to see the item. The toy is very durable and felt value for money.

Assembly is bit time consuming. Nearly took 30 mins to assemble in place. Compared to Scalextric I felt it is time consuming which I can put in place within 10 mins. Once all in place it takes a while to master the technique in getting the trains rolling across the whole track. LIke my previous reviewer, my son got frustrated (inluding me) at the beginning. However, a second go placing the track at right flat floor, helped us master the trick.

It needs bit of a strength to turn the lever which I would say may be difficult for a 5 year boy.

Pros,
1. steady and strong
2. fun to get the engines running and a nice time pass

Cons,
1. the liver comes off after many turns if not turned with the right pressure.
2. assembly
3. all Chuggington Die-cast train doesnot work on track.. few works

Overall I recommend, but with a note to say that it needs adult assistance even for a 5 year old.

This toy is complete rubbish. It was brought as a gift for our two boys aged two and four and a half. I was not expecting the two year old to be able to use it but thought that as it said 3+ on the box it might be able to be used by the older boy. I can't even get it to work properly and I'm 39! After assembling it (not that easy) you have to turn the handle round with one hand very fast, then with the other hand (whilst turning the handle) press the button to release the train. The train barely makes it up the first hill, let alone having enough energy to make it all the way round the remainder of the track. There's no way a small child could do this on their own and get any fun out of it. My four and a half year old said to me "Daddy, the shop is very silly to sell this toy". Absolutely.
